Thunderstorms and heavy rain are set to affect large parts of Finland at the start of the week as an unstable weather front moves across the country. Forecasters expect the most active storms on Monday and Tuesday before high pressure brings calmer conditions from the middle of the week.
Foreca said the strongest thunderstorms are expected in eastern Finland and Kainuu on Monday before shifting towards northern Finland on Tuesday.
Meteorologist Kristian Roine said conditions will begin to improve from Wednesday as a high-pressure system moves in from the southwest.
